Helping your employees through a career transition

Redundancy can often come as a shock to employees while others may welcome it. Some will see it as an opportunity to develop new skills and embrace new challenges, while others may feel a sense of loss that a role they enjoyed is coming to an end. The current employer can help make this transition easier by providing outplacement assistance.

Career outplacement services, sometimes referred to as ‘career transition’, provide employees who are leaving the organisation with support to help them in the job market. They help them to find a new post, increase their confidence, and discover new inspiration.

Redundancy outplacement support can make a key difference for individuals whose employment is being terminated, helping them face the future with confidence. With the right support in place, employees can better compete in the jobs market and find suitable employment sooner.

Stage 1 – Workshops

Delivered in-house or online, these 90-minute group sessions are dedicated to enhancing employability. Each session covers a key stage in the journey towards securing a new role, whilst looking to instil confidence and optimism in prospective job seekers.

A brief agenda for each workshop can be found below.

CV Writing

  • Understanding the purpose and value of a CV
  • Producing a professional CV
  • Avoiding common mistakes
  • Reviewing and refreshing an existing CV

Job Hunting

  • Establishing key skills and interests
  • Deciding on a new opportunity
  • Knowing where to look for these opportunities

Interview Preparation

  • Conducting research on the role and company
  • Preparing for potential interview questions
  • Planning, presenting, and practising
  • Asking the right questions
